The study of Life-science is very important in 21st century, and Amino acid analysis is one of the most important technologies in the life-science research. The main methods for amino acid analysis are reviewed. These methods include ion exchange chromatography(IEC),high performance liquid chromatography(HPLC),gas chromatography(GC) and capillary electrophoresis(CE). But it is rare to use multivariate calibration titration to study the amino acid. Multivariate calibration titration belongs to potentiometric titration. This method is based on the proportion between the concentration of the unknown sample and the volume of the titration. The determination of pure and mixed amino acids is studied by automatic potentiometric titrator, with NaOH as the titrant, whose concentratioin is settled, Hydrogen ion selective electrode as the directing electrode, Ag-AgCl electrode as the inside-reference-electrode, 1.0mol/L NaNO3 as ionic strength adjustment buffer, and when it's necessary,0.02mol/L HCl is used to adjust the acidity of the solution. The job includes:(1) The concentration of Glu, Ser, His, Ala, Lys is determined and the results can be accepted.The errors are basically under 3%.(2) The concentration of the mixed amino acids is determined,such as Glu and Ser,His and Glu,Ser and His,Glu and Ala,His and Lys, the results are satisfying. The errors of the determination are all under 5%. Two potential ranges are selected in the determination of Ser and His,so the cumulative errors increase,the errors of this group are a little big correspondingly.(3) The existent form of amino acids is investigated and the sequence of the reactions between different amino acids,then do further research on the regularity of their ionization equilibrium constants and the pH of the different kinds of amino acids.(4)According to their titration curves, the reaction in the mixed amino acids is studied.On this basis, a summary is made on how to select the working potential of multivariate calibration titration.(5) The factors which may cause errors are discussed.(6) The virtue and the limitation of the determination of amino acid by multivariate calibration titrimetry is summarized.
